New Clutch Shaking Going Into 1st?!?

Hello,

My OEM clutch went out on me about 3 weeks ago. I immediately bought the ACT clutch kit with normal FW and also the Verus Engineering Fork, Verus Pivot Billet (I think that's what it's called), and the updated Toyota Throwout bearing with the white dot and I tossed out the other that came with the kit. I've had the car back with the new clutch for about 2 almost 3 weeks. I've been focusing on street driving and taking it easy whole the clutch is being broken in. This is my first clutch that i break in. When i go into first the car feels as if it's going to stall and I have to rev it up a bit more than I used to I'd say almost 1.5k Rpm as opposed to about 500-800. All the other gears are buttery smooth expect for 1st and Revese but we all know reverse is extremely high. Is the shaking normal while its breaking in?
